
Cambridge Symphony Orchestra Performs Prokofiev's Romeo and Juliet
Saturday, June 17, under the leadership of Cynthia Woods, Cambridge Symphony Orchestra (CSO) performs a semi-staged version of Prokofiev's "Romeo and Juliet," a romantic favorite, choreographed and produced by Gianni Gino Di Marco, former principal dancer of the Boston Ballet. Cambridge Symphony Orchestra's rendition of "Romeo and Juliet" promises to be a captivating journey through the complexities of passion and destiny. Through an evening of music and dance, the performance will explore themes of power, violence plus the struggle for personal freedom and love through a rigid feudal world controlled by powerful and wealthy families.
